The Interior Design Process:
1) Initial Consultation (Complimentary)
For existing interior design renovations we meet in your space and for new construction, we meet at the site. We listen to your ideas and take detailed notes. From there we analyze the opportunities and challenges presented.
2) Design Retainer
We then meet again to review a letter of agreement to commence design services. A design retainer launches your design work.
3) Project Evaluation – Programming and Analysis
Determination of the specific needs and goals for your unique project.
4) Conceptual Design Phase
Preliminary space plan drawings are formulated with traffic flow patterns with options for you to choose from.
5) Schematic Design Phase
Scaled drawings are developed from the chosen Conceptual Plan including floor plans, elevations, section drawings and sketches as needed. Depending on the level of work required to accomplish your vision, renovations requiring plumbing, mechanical, electrical and reflected ceiling plans are services that can be included for you.
6) Preliminary client review and evaluation
At this stage, you will review the drawings created during the Schematic Design Phase and approve or make recommendations for revisions until approved.
7) Design Development
Next the design gets detailed with mill work, wall, flooring, and window treatments with accompanying samples. Furniture, fixtures and fabrics are also selected and incorporated into the design of your interior later in this stage. Custom furniture drawings are created if required. A presentation is prepared with specification lists with budgetary numbers and alternate choices. Field trips to vendors for selections are typically necessary at this stage.
8) Preliminary Presentation at Design Development Stage
At this point you will confirm the design and / or make any replacement choices.
9) Purchasing and Procurement, Design Implementation
Purchases are defined and purchase orders created to include specifications, delivery estimates and freight costs. You will finalize everything to guarantee your satisfaction.
10) Installation, Project Management
Next my firm will follow up on all orders, coordinate and oversee installation of mill work, flooring, wall treatments, specialty fixtures and window treatments and all merchandise deliveries are scheduled.
11) Post evaluation
Upon completion of your project, you will evaluate your project results and we will define any unfinished details. Your complete satisfaction is my goal as my business is based on satisfied clients and referrals.
